On Feb. 3, 2005 The Tibetan Photo Project exhibitwill premiere at Antioch University at 400 Corporate Pointe Road in Culver City at 5:30 p.m.

The Tibetan Photo Project offers the first collection of photos taken by Tibetans living in exile, images of the Dalai Lama, informational texts and rare 1932 pictures of Tibet

The perspective provided from the modern history of Tibet and China reveals a great deal about the nature of China's future leadership. The lessons have become even more relevant with the rise to power by Hu Jintao, China's former hard-line secretary to Tibet.



The opening and the exhibit which will run through until May is free to the public.

Co-founder Joe Mickey will present slides and a lecture on "China Rising." at 7 p.m.
